Overview

Arifa Institute of Technology is a private engineering and technical institution located in India, offering undergraduate and postgraduate programmes in various branches of engineering and applied sciences. Like many private technical colleges established in India during the expansion of higher technical education, the institute operates under the regulatory framework of the All India Council for Technical Education (AICTE) and is affiliated to a state technical university. The institution caters primarily to students seeking professional engineering degrees and technical qualifications in a structured campus environment.

The institute is part of the broader landscape of private engineering colleges that grew significantly across India following the liberalisation of technical education in the 1990s and 2000s, particularly in states with strong demand for engineering graduates. Institutions of this type typically offer the Bachelor of Engineering (B.E.) or Bachelor of Technology (B.Tech) degree as their primary qualification, alongside diploma and postgraduate options in select disciplines.

Admissions

Admissions to undergraduate engineering programmes at Arifa Institute of Technology are conducted through the state-level engineering entrance process, which varies by state. In most Indian states, admission to private engineering colleges is managed through a centralised counselling mechanism operated by the state government or a designated authority. Eligibility for the B.Tech programme generally requires completion of Class XII with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ics as core subjects, along with a qualifying score in the relevant entrance examination.

Management quota seats, where applicable, may be filled through direct institutional admission processes as permitted under state regulations. Reservation policies follow the norms prescribed by the state government and applicable central guidelines.
